位置:科技教程网 > 资讯中心 > 科技问答 > 文章详情

linux版本有哪些

作者:科技教程网
|
92人看过
发布时间:2026-01-27 01:15:14
标签:linux版本
面对众多linux版本,用户真正需要的是根据自身技术背景、应用场景和硬件条件,从数百个发行版中筛选出最适合的解决方案。本文将系统梳理主流发行版的分类体系,通过对比桌面环境、软件生态、稳定性等核心维度,帮助初学者避开选择陷阱,为运维人员推荐企业级方案,最终让读者掌握自主选择linux版本的方法论。
linux版本有哪些

       linux版本有哪些

       当新手推开开源世界的大门,往往会被琳琅满目的linux版本(常称为发行版)所震撼。从简洁优雅的Ubuntu(乌班图)到稳定如山的CentOS(社区企业操作系统),从高度可定制的Arch Linux(拱门Linux)到为树莓派优化的Raspbian(树莓派操作系统),这些各具特色的系统构成了庞大的生态森林。要理清头绪,我们需要从发展脉络、适用场景和技术特性三个维度构建认知框架。

       发行版家族的谱系溯源

       所有现代发行版都可追溯至几个核心祖先。1991年林纳斯·托瓦兹发布初版内核时,用户需要手动组合编译器、库文件和基础工具,这种复杂性催生了早期发行版。1993年诞生的Debian(德班)确立了"稳定至上"的哲学,其严格的软件包管理机制影响深远;同年问世的Slackware(松弛软件)则以极简设计成为定制化发行的鼻祖。红帽公司1995年推出的Red Hat Linux(红帽Linux)开创了商业支持模式,其衍生的Fedora(费多拉)成为创新试验田,而CentOS则延续了企业级稳定性基因。

       理解这种谱系关系至关重要。比如基于Debian的Ubuntu继承了apt软件包管理体系和稳定基座,而基于Red Hat的Rocky Linux(岩石Linux)则天然兼容RHEL(红帽企业版Linux)生态。掌握家族脉络后,我们可将主流发行版归为三大阵营:Debian系适合追求易用性的用户,Red Hat系满足企业级需求,独立发行版则提供特殊价值,如Gentoo(真图)的源码编译优化和NixOS(尼克斯操作系统)的原子级回滚特性。

       桌面环境的选择艺术

       图形界面是用户感知最直接的部分。GNOME(格诺姆)环境以现代化设计见长,Ubuntu默认配置通过顶栏整合系统状态;KDE Plasma(KDE等离子)则提供类似Windows的熟悉布局,其微件引擎支持深度个性化。追求性能的用户可选Xfce(X窗口系统轻量级桌面环境),在老旧设备上流畅运行;极简主义者则青睐i3wm(i3窗口管理器),通过键盘驱动所有操作。

       不同发行版对桌面环境的整合策略各异。Linux Mint(Linux薄荷)专门优化Cinnamon(肉桂)环境,提供类似传统桌面的交互逻辑;Manjaro(曼扎罗)为Arch系用户提供开箱即用的桌面体验。选择时需权衡资源占用与功能完整性,例如GNOME适合触摸设备但内存消耗较大,而LXQt(轻量级Qt桌面环境)在512MB内存设备上仍能流畅运行。

       软件包管理器的核心差异

       这是区分发行版的技术关键。Debian系使用apt(高级软件包工具)配合dpkg(Debian软件包管理器),命令直观且依赖自动解决;Red Hat系采用yum/dnf(黄色狗更新工具/毛刺鼻更新工具),强调事务性操作与回滚能力。Arch系独创的Pacman(吃豆人)工具速度极快,配合AUR(Arch用户仓库)可获取海量第三方软件。

       新兴的跨发行版方案正在突破界限,Flatpak(扁平包)和Snap(快照包)通过容器化技术实现软件隔离。但传统包管理器仍不可替代,例如openSUSE(开放SUSE)的Zypper(齐珀)工具支持依赖解析算法,能精准处理复杂软件关系。选择时需考虑软件源质量,Ubuntu官方仓库包含数万经测试的软件包,而Arch的滚动更新模式让用户始终使用最新版本。

       新手入门的黄金选择

       对于首次接触Linux的用户,Ubuntu LTS(长期支持版)是最稳妥的选择。其硬件兼容性经过广泛测试,图形化安装程序支持双系统部署,庞大的社区确保问题能快速解决。Linux Mint在此基础上进一步优化,预装多媒体解码器并提供更传统的界面布局,降低从Windows过渡的认知成本。

       如果希望体验最新技术又不失稳定性,Fedora Workstation(费多拉工作站)是理想选择。其每半年发布新版,集成Wayland(韦兰)显示服务器等先进特性,默认的GNOME环境经过精心调校。这些发行版都提供Live CD( live光盘)功能,无需安装即可体验系统全貌。

       服务器领域的王者之争

       企业环境中,CentOS的继任者Rocky Linux和AlmaLinux(阿尔玛Linux)成为RHEL替代品的首选,它们提供长达10年的安全更新,完全兼容企业级软件生态。Debian稳定版以"坚如磐石"著称,其保守的软件版本策略确保生产环境万无一失。

       Ubuntu Server(乌班图服务器)凭借云原生优势异军突起,其对容器和DevOps工具链的深度整合受到开发者青睐。对于需要认证硬件的场景,SUSE Linux Enterprise Server(SUSE Linux企业服务器)提供全球技术支持,特别在金融和医疗领域应用广泛。

       开发者的定制化乐园

       程序员群体偏爱Arch Linux的极致透明,其Wiki文档被誉为"安装说明书",PKGBUILD构建脚本让软件编译过程完全可控。Gentoo更进一步,允许通过USE标志精细调整编译选项,为特定硬件架构生成优化代码。

       基于Debian testing(测试版)的Solus(独行侠)专为桌面优化,集成了Budgie(知更鸟)等独创环境;NixOS的革命性包管理机制支持多版本共存,开发环境可精确复现。这些发行版虽然学习曲线陡峭,但能给予开发者完全的系统控制权。

       特殊场景的专用方案

       嵌入式设备领域,Yocto Project(约克托项目)不是发行版而是构建框架,允许定制最小化系统;Raspberry Pi OS(树莓派操作系统)则针对ARM架构优化,预装编程教育工具。网络安全从业者常用Kali Linux(卡利Linux),整合数百种渗透测试工具;多媒体创作者可选Ubuntu Studio(乌班图工作室),内置低延迟内核和专业音视频软件。

       对于老旧硬件,Puppy Linux(小狗Linux)仅需300MB内存即可运行;Alpine Linux(高山Linux)以安全性著称,适合容器基础镜像。这些专用发行版证明Linux生态的多样性远超通用操作系统。

       版本迭代模式的权衡

       固定发布版如Ubuntu每两年推出LTS版,适合求稳的用户;滚动更新版如Arch持续推送软件包,始终提供最新功能。中间路线如Fedora每半年发布大版本,既保持创新性又控制风险。企业级系统通常采用"发布后冻结"策略,仅向后移植安全补丁,确保API稳定性。

       选择时需评估更新容忍度:滚动更新可能引入不兼容变更,而固定版本需等待周期升级才能获得新功能。对于开发机器,Arch的及时更新能提前适配新技术;对于生产服务器,CentOS的保守策略更能保障业务连续性。

       社区支持与商业背书

       Debian由全球志愿者协同开发,其民主治理模式确保中立性;Ubuntu背后有Canonical(规范公司)提供商业支持,企业用户可购买技术服务。红帽公司通过订阅模式为RHEL提供认证、补丁和法规合规支持,这是开源商业化的成功典范。

       社区活力直接影响使用体验,Arch Wiki的详尽程度堪称典范,而新兴发行版可能面临文档缺失问题。选择时建议考察论坛活跃度、错误追踪系统响应速度,以及是否具备本地化支持资源。

       硬件兼容性考量要点

       主流发行版对英特尔/AMD平台支持良好,但特殊设备需特别注意。Ubuntu默认包含专有驱动,适合NVIDIA显卡用户;Fedora坚持开源原则,需手动安装第三方驱动。对于最新硬件,滚动发行版通常率先提供内核支持,而服务器系统更注重对ECC内存、RAID卡等企业级硬件的验证。

       ARM架构设备存在碎片化问题,树莓派有官方优化系统,其他开发板可能需要自行编译内核。选择前应查看硬件兼容列表,或使用Live镜像进行实测。

       安全机制的纵深防御

       现代发行版都集成安全增强功能。SELinux(安全增强型Linux)在Red Hat系默认启用,提供强制访问控制;AppArmor(应用装甲)是Ubuntu的首选方案,配置相对简单。FirewallD(防火墙守护进程)和UFW(简单防火墙)简化了网络规则管理。

       安全更新响应速度是关键差异点,企业发行版通常提供CVE(通用漏洞披露)补丁的SLA(服务级别协议)。对于高安全环境,可考虑Clair(克莱尔)等容器漏洞扫描工具集成方案。

       容器时代的发行版演进

       随着容器技术普及,发行版角色正在转变。CoreOS(核心操作系统)开创了不可变系统理念,如今发展为Flatcar Container Linux(平板车容器Linux);Ubuntu推出MicroK8s(微K8s)实现单节点Kubernetes(库伯内特斯)快速部署。

       轻量级发行版如Alpine成为Docker镜像首选基础,其5MB的体积极大减少攻击面。传统发行版也积极适应变化,RHEL提供UBI(通用基础镜像),允许企业合规使用红帽认证的容器镜像。

       选择决策的实践指南

       最终决策应基于实际需求矩阵:桌面用户优先考察硬件兼容性和软件生态,开发者关注工具链完整性,运维人员重视稳定性和支持周期。建议制作评估表格,对比不同发行版在包管理、更新策略、文档质量等维度的得分。

       实践层面可先使用虚拟机多方案测试,重点验证常用工作流程的顺畅度。记住Linux世界的自由在于可随时迁移,初始选择不必追求完美,随着经验积累可逐步调整方向。无论选择哪个linux版本,参与社区贡献和持续学习才是开源精神的真谛。

       通过以上十二个维度的系统分析,我们不仅回答了"linux版本有哪些"的表层问题,更构建了自主评估操作系统适配性的能力。这种认知框架将帮助用户在技术浪潮中始终保持清醒的选择判断,让开源系统真正成为赋能个人成长和企业数字化的基石。

推荐文章
相关文章
推荐URL
本文将系统梳理Linux操作系统中常见的文件系统类型,涵盖传统EXT系列、高性能XFS、集群文件系统及新兴技术,通过对比特性、适用场景和实操建议,帮助用户根据数据安全、性能需求和硬件环境选择最佳存储方案,为深入理解Linux文件系统提供全面参考。
2026-01-27 01:14:03
162人看过
针对"Linux 学哪些"这一核心问题,本文将为不同学习目标的学习者系统梳理从基础命令、系统管理到网络服务、安全运维等12个关键知识模块,通过分阶段学习路径规划帮助初学者避免盲目摸索,为进阶者指明专业技能深化方向。
2026-01-27 01:13:20
380人看过
面对"linux 系统有哪些"的提问,用户真正需要的是系统化的分类指南和选型建议。本文将深入解析主流linux 系统发行版的三大技术谱系及其应用场景,从桌面应用到企业服务器,从嵌入式设备到云计算平台,通过对比核心特性、适用领域和典型代表,帮助读者构建清晰的认知框架,避免选择困难。
2026-01-27 01:12:43
228人看过
对于在Linux操作系统上寻找专业室内设计工具的用户而言,当前确实存在多款功能各异的软件选择,它们覆盖了从二维平面布局到三维模型渲染的完整工作流程。本文将系统梳理适用于Linux平台的室内设计软件,包括开源免费的Blender与Sweet Home 3D,以及通过兼容层运行的商业软件方案,同时详细分析各类工具的核心功能、学习曲线与协作特性,帮助设计师根据项目需求选择最合适的linux室内设计软件解决方案。
2026-01-27 01:04:21
188人看过
热门推荐
热门专题: